Subject: Pool cut-over summary

Team — the migration to the shared PgGrove connection pooler completed Sunday without downtime. All four services now route through the pooler; direct connections are revoked. We observed a 40% drop in idle connections and no timeout regressions during the soak period. Rollback scripts remain staged for two weeks. The pooler now runs with these configuration values.

settings of tagef-bawif:
DRUIX_HOST=druix.zemvarlabs.internal
DRUIX_PORT=8000

Minutes — Management Meeting, Oakrest Group. Attendees reviewed the proposed sale of the Pellan Instruments unit to Varrow Capital. Mr. Dunmore confirmed diligence is complete and staff consultations begin next week. Branch managers must route all inquiries to the transition office and make no external statements. Timelines and responsibilities were circulated separately. The confidential commercial rationale is recorded immediately below.

management briefing: Project Ulavan slips by two quarters because of the staffing delay.

Subject: FX rounding fix shipped

Maintainers: the Quillbank converter was rounding per line item instead of per invoice, producing off-by-one-cent totals in multi-currency orders. Fixed by accumulating in minor units and rounding once at settlement. Regression tests added for the yen and dinar paths. Do not revert without reading the linked design note. Patched build token follows below.

build token for fahap-yagag: htk3_d09

The Fennelwick gateway wraps all calls to the upstream Cartographa API in a circuit breaker. After five consecutive failures within 30 seconds, the breaker opens and requests fail fast for two minutes. Half-open probes send one request per 15 seconds until two succeed. Support can check breaker state via the /breaker/status endpoint on the internal ops plane. Do not reset the breaker manually unless the upstream team confirms recovery. Status queries authenticate with the key below.

API key for yahig-tadup: kto7_ubizbYm